>Can anybody tell me what was illegal about the curvature of Cronan's stick?
>And how exactly does one spot such a thing during the game?
>
 
Well, the gone-but-certainly-not-forgotten Shawn Walsh called this several
times over the last few seasons, most notably in my mind at a game vs. UNH
at the Snively.  Boy, did he **** off some coaches for that.  And always
this waited until late in close games.
 
How do you notice ?  Train someone in the stands to look over the
opponent's stick area on their bench, then report their findings to your
team room or the "eye in the sky" during the game.
